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b fresh lump crab meat
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 2 green onions (finely chopped)
- 2 tbsp lemon juice (freshly squeezed)
- 1 tbsp Old Bay seasoning
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cooking oil (for frying)
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ine crab meat, panko breadcrumbs,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, green onions, lemon juice, Old Bay seasoning, paprika, salt, and pepper. Mix gently without breaking the crab too much.
- Cover and refrigerate the mixture for at least 30 minutes to allow flavors to meld and bind.
- Form the mixture into patties about 1-inch thick.
-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at until shimmering. Carefully add patties without overcrowding.
- Cook for 4–5 minutes on each side until golden brown and crispy.
- Transfer to paper towels to drain excess oil and serve warm with tartar sauce or aioli.
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 10 minutes
